Selling a house can be a daunting task, especially if you're considering the for sale by owner (FSBO) route. However, with the right knowledge and approach, selling your house without an agent can be a rewarding and cost-effective experience. In this expert review, we will guide you through the process of selling your house for sale by owner in the US, providing you with valuable insights and tips to ensure a successful sale.

  1. Preparing Your House: Before listing your house, it's essential to make it appeal to potential buyers. Start by decluttering and organizing your home, making it look spacious and inviting. Repairs and minor renovations can also significantly increase the property's value. Consider freshening up the paint, updating fixtures, and enhancing curb appeal through landscaping. Remember, the more attractive your house looks, the faster it will sell.

  2. Pricing Your Property: Determining the right price for your house is crucial. Conduct thorough research to understand the local real estate market trends and analyze recent sales data for comparable properties. FSBO sellers in Texas can use a service to have their home listed on their local MLS, often for a flat fee. Websites like Houzeo, FSBO and Texas MLS Broker offer MLS packages for owners selling without an agent. Some packages come with yard signs, and they can often be purchased at hardware stores too.

Who pays closing costs in Texas?

Buyers and sellers Who pays closing costs in Texas? Buyers and sellers both have closing costs to cover in Texas (as is the case in all states). Sellers absorb the bulk of the costs in most cases, including covering the commissions for both real estate agents involved in the sale.

What should I remove from my house before selling it?

Before showing the house to potential buyers, remove anything personalizing your home to you: family photos, diplomas, toiletries, toothbrushes, etc. You'll also want to remove any items that clutter your house, such as excess furniture and even the items in that kitchen junk drawer.

Can I sell my house without a realtor in Ohio?
Selling without an agent means you'll only pay the buyer's agent commission — typically 2.62%, or $5,569. So, selling a house by owner in Ohio could save you around 2.62%, or $5,569, on commissions. While it's typical for both the listing agent and buyer's agent to split the real estate commission, it's not required.
